Tires seem to be a HOT topic!

Just talked to the Tire Rack -

They have only ONE reinforced tire available in the 205/70 R14 size:

Michelin MXT for $91 each (even though these are not shown on their pages)

They also have some XCH4 tires available not the 205, but a 185 width at $84 They also have an MX 'reinforced' tire in the 185 width for $65.

Some of the LT tires look interesting. The LTX M/S in a P205/75 SR14 is $78, but today's guy said that this is not a 'reinforced' tire and would not be strong enough for the Vanagon. (My how the info remains confusing!)

Harvey - who told you that these were the replacement for the XCH4's? It does seem that you think this tire is fine? Yet the TireRack guy says "they aren't strong enough for the Vanagon."
